  • Patent number: 5984504
    Abstract: A safety or protection system includes a plurality of divisions of first signals; a plurality of safety or protection subsystems each of which receives a corresponding one of the divisions of first signals and produces a corresponding plurality of second signals therefrom; and a reflective memory subsystem for communicating the second signals between the safety or protection subsystems.

  • Patent number: 5402524
    Abstract: An artificial intelligence software shell for plant operation simulation includes a blackboard module including a database having objects representing plant elements and concepts. A rule-based knowledge source module and a case-based knowledge source module, in communication with the blackboard module, operate on specific predefined blackboard objects. The case-based knowledge source module includes cases having past data points on a time scale. Present data is compared with the past data in the cases both on a time scale and on a magnitude scale for determining levels of closeness in time and magnitude. An input data module, in communication with the blackboard module, enables a user to input data to the shell. A control module, in communication with the knowledge source modules and the input data module, receives all input data and controls operation of the knowledge source modules in accordance with a predetermined knowledge source priority scheme.

  • Patent number: 4820032
    Abstract: An automated angulating mirror controlled through electronics, hydraulics, and pneumatics, to view the movements of a vehicle in respect to a trailer pivotably mounted.

  • Patent number: 4674300
    Abstract: A knitting machine with a needle drive drum revolution counter that indicates the number of fabric rows knit. A cam rotates with the needle drive drum pivoting a switching arm that advances the counter.
